Transaction 989556905facf59606d636e83324618b74b0b60b994e1e4d6f6849791771d193
1 Input
1 Output
-
989556905facf59606d636e83324618b74b0b60b994e1e4d6f6849791771d193:0
- value
- 6313977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63235777b4268fa1ceb2ee66cc1f8e49c098738e OP_EQUAL
- address
- 3AjDA7kjeMVbsiQXGxLKU3WiVwvnzATnu9